Denman Community Land Trust Association Progress and Challenges on Seniors Housing
development · Near the Guesthouse, Denman Island
The Denman Community Land Trust Association (DCLTA) is advancing an eight-unit Seniors Affordable Housing project on two acres near the Guesthouse. The project faces regulatory complexity involving multiple agencies and land use restrictions including ALR exclusion and density limits. The DCLTA emphasizes community consultation and sustainable design standards.

- “Seniors’ Affordable Housing will be an eight-unit development... on two acres of land next to the Guesthouse... The project had to apply for exclusion of the land from the ALR... The Official Community Plan supports... a 5% increase over the buildout... The DCLTA has an egalitarian structure... The Seniors’ project is going to go for total passive heating... accessible design, and a purple pipe wastewater conservation system.” — The Islands Grapevine – May 2nd, 2019 (May 2nd, 2019)
